哈喽,大家好呀,欢迎走进体检知音的网站,说实在的啊现在体检也越来越重要,不少的朋友也因为体检不合格导致了和心仪的工作失之交臂,担心不合格可以找体检知音帮忙处理一下,关于java语言为什么具有可移植性、以及j***a语言具有可移植性,是与平台无关的编程语言的知识点,小编会在本文中详细的给大家介绍到,也希望能够帮助到大家的

本文目录一览:

j***a数据库具有什么特点保证软件可移植性

简单性、面向对象、分布式、解释型、可靠、安全、平台无关、可移植、高性能、多线程、动态性等。 下面我们将重点介绍J***a语言的面向对象、平台无关、分布式、多线程、可靠和安全等特性。

java语言为什么具有可移植性(java语言具有可移植性,是与平台无关的编程语言)
(图片来源网络,侵删)

跨平台/可移植性 这是J***a的核心优势。J***a在设计时就很注重移植和跨平台性。比如:J***a的int永远都是32位。不像C++可能是16,32,可能是根据编译器厂商规定的变化。这样的话程序的移植就会非常麻烦。

J***a是一种跨平台,适合于分布式计算环境的面向对象编程语言。具体来说,它具有如下特性:简单性、面向对象、分布式、解释型、可靠、安全、平台无关、可移植、高性能、多线程、动态性等。

java语言为什么具有可移植性(java语言具有可移植性,是与平台无关的编程语言)
(图片来源网络,侵删)

数据结构化 数据库系统实现了整体数据的结构化,这是数据库的最主要的特征之一。

⑵数据分布:将数据分别存放在不同的主机上,这些主机是网络中的不同成员。可移植性:J***a程序具有与体系结构无关的特性。J***a的类库也提供了针对不同平台的接口,所有这些类库也可以被移植。

java语言为什么具有可移植性(java语言具有可移植性,是与平台无关的编程语言)
(图片来源网络,侵删)

J***a语言 J***a语言有下面一些特点 :简单、面向对象、分布式、解释执行、鲁棒、安全、体系结构中立、可移植、高性能、多线程以及动态性。

J***a主要有那些特性?

可移植性:J***a程序具有与体系结构无关的特性。J***a的类库也提供了针对不同平台的接口,所有这些类库也可以被移植。

J***a的强类型机制,异常处理,自动垃圾收集等是J***a程序健壮性的重要保证。丢弃指针是J***a的明智选择。J***a的安全检查机制使J***a更加健壮。

健壮特性:j***a***取了一个安全指针模型,能减小重写内存和数据崩溃的可能型。安全:j***a用来设计网路和分布系统,这带来了新的安全问题,j***a可以用来构建防***和防攻击的system。事实证明j***a在防毒这一方面做的比较好。

简单性J***a吸收了C++语言的各种优点,丢弃了C++里难以理解的概念,具有简单性。 J***a能够自动处理对象的引用和间接引用,实现自动的无用单元收集,使用户不必为存储管理问题烦恼,能更多的时间和精力花在研发上。

J***a三大特性的应用和作用教程:J***a封装:封装可以隐藏类的内部属性,并且对用户隐藏了数据的访问方式,这样可以保护类的内部状态。封装可以防止类中的方法访问属性,防止对象间的交互,提高J***a程序的安全性。

J***a的可移植性为什么比较好

1、***粘贴,J***a不仅仅适于在网页上内嵌动画—它是一门极好的完全的软件编程的小语言。“虚拟机”机制、垃圾回收以及没有指针等使它很容易实现不易崩溃且不会泄漏***的可靠程序。移植性接近零。

2、跨平台性 所谓的跨平台性,是指软件可以不受计算机硬件和操作系统的约束而在任意计算机环境下正常运行。这是软件发展的趋势和编程人员追求的目标。

3、跨平台/可移植性 这是J***a的核心优势。J***a在设计时就很注重移植和跨平台性。比如:J***a的int永远都是32位。不像C++可能是16,32,可能是根据编译器厂商规定的变化。这样的话程序的移植就会非常麻烦。

4、J***A作为一种编程语言:源代码可移植性 作为一种编程语言,J***A提供了一种最简单同时也是人们最熟悉的可移植性–源代码移植。

5、J***a的优点如下:J***a简单,易于设计,易于编写,因此比其他任何J***a都易于编译,调试和学习。J***a是面向对象的,用于构建模块化程序和其他应用程序中的可重用代码。J***a与平台无关,可移植***。

J***a语言的主要特点是什么

错了,主要特征是:封装、继承、多态、抽象。你列的是j***a的有点,跨平台。

多线程性。J***a应用程序可以在同一时间并行执行多项任务。而且相应的同步机制可以保证不同线程能够正确地共享数据。高性能性 J***a编译后的字节码是在解释器中运行的,所以它的速度较多数交互式运用程序提高了很多。

封装、继承、多态、抽象是j***a语言的四大特点,J***a语言作为静态面向对象编程语言的代表,极好地实现了面向对象理论,允许程序员以优雅的思维方式进行复杂的编程。

J***a语言是开发分发的软件的理想,因为它具有强大的、易于使用的网络能力,在基本的J***a应用软件的接口中,以网络为基础的方案接口。昆明IT培训发现J***a应用软件可以进入遥控物体,如进入当地档案系统。

j***a的可移植性是什么意思?移植到哪里去?

1、J***A作为一种编程语言:源代码可移植性 作为一种编程语言,J***A提供了一种最简单同时也是人们最熟悉的可移植性–源代码移植。

2、可移植性意思是指程序可以在不同计算机操作系统上运行的属性。可移植性是软件质量之一,良好的可移植性可以提高软件的生命周期。

3、就是说程序在完成后,可以直接搬用到其他的平台上。完成其他平台的需求。这样可以避免代码的重复编写 给编程带来很大方便。

4、解释性:J***A代码不会被编译为可执行文档,而是把生成字节码,只有在运行时字节码才被解释为机器码并执行相应的功能。

5、软件可移植性是指代码可以在不同平台间移植,硬件移植性是指在不同硬件间(如不同构架的CPU)移植。

6、可移植性:J***a程序具有与体系结构无关的特性。J***a的类库也提供了针对不同平台的接口,所有这些类库也可以被移植。

简述j***a程序的可移植性

遇到这种情况,程序员就只能写不可移植的程序了。总之,J***A在可移植性方面的特点使它在Internet上具有广泛的应用前景。同时它本身具有的防***的能力也使它在需要高可靠性的应用中占有一席之地。

跨平台/可移植性 这是J***a的核心优势。J***a在设计时就很注重移植和跨平台性。比如:J***a的int永远都是32位。不像C++可能是16,32,可能是根据编译器厂商规定的变化。这样的话程序的移植就会非常麻烦。

也就是说不同操作平台有自己的jvm但是jvm向上的字节码接口是与平台无关的,jvm接口向下是与硬件有关的,jvm是个中间件,这样只要有字节码和jvm,不管在任何平台都可以运行j***a程序。

⑵数据分布:将数据分别存放在不同的主机上,这些主机是网络中的不同成员。可移植性:J***a程序具有与体系结构无关的特性。J***a的类库也提供了针对不同平台的接口,所有这些类库也可以被移植。

最后,关于 j***a语言为什么具有可移植性和j***a语言具有可移植性,是与平台无关的编程语言的知识点,相信大家都有所了解了吧,也希望帮助大家的同时,也请大家支持我一下,关于体检任何问题都可以找体检知音的帮忙的!